Sword Art Online: Fatal Bullet Story Detailed

Bandai Namco’s Sword Art Online: Fatal Bullet, the new game based on the bafflingly successful anime and cross media franchise, is almost here- at least, for fans of the series in the west. Ahead of its release later this week, the publisher has decided to share more story details about it.

The game will see you enter the Gun Gale Online game, where you unexpectedly obtain the ArFA-Sys, and have to collect all its parts and keys before you are admitted to a spaceship, which is an additional dungeon that everyone playing the game seems to be trying to conquer.

I’m sure that for fans of the anime, that sounds exciting (to me, it sounds like a whole bunch of absolutely nothing, but hey, this game is clearly not for me). Sword Art Online: Fatal Bullet is due to launch on the PS4, Xbox One, and PC on February 23 in North America and Europe.
